Kombai Capabilities
Converts Figma design files directly into production-ready React component code with proper structure, props, and component hierarchy. Automatically translates design layers into functional React components with appropriate nesting and composition patterns.
Converts Figma design files directly into production-ready Vue component code with proper template structure, script logic, and styling. Automatically translates design layers into Vue single-file components with appropriate composition.
Automatically converts Figma design properties (colors, typography, spacing, shadows, borders, etc.) into corresponding CSS code. Eliminates manual CSS writing by extracting and translating all visual styling from designs.
Provides a Figma plugin that enables designers to export code directly from within Figma without leaving the design tool. Streamlines the workflow by integrating code generation into the design environment.
Accelerates frontend development by automatically generating 40-60% of component code, allowing developers to focus on logic, interactions, and refinement rather than boilerplate styling and markup. Measures and demonstrates time savings in development cycles.
Extracts and preserves design tokens (colors, typography, spacing, etc.) from Figma during code generation, maintaining design intent and enabling consistent styling across generated components. Maps Figma design tokens to code-based token systems.
Automatically converts Figma responsive breakpoints and layout constraints into responsive CSS/styling code that maintains the design's intended behavior across different screen sizes. Preserves responsive design decisions from Figma.
Generates Tailwind CSS utility classes directly from Figma designs, creating styled components that use Tailwind's utility-first approach. Automatically maps design properties to appropriate Tailwind classes.

Replit Capabilities
Replit allows multiple users to edit code simultaneously in a shared environment using WebSocket connections for real-time updates. This architecture ensures that all changes are instantly reflected across all users' screens, enhancing collaborative coding experiences. The platform also integrates version control to manage changes effectively, allowing users to revert to previous states if needed.
Unique: Utilizes WebSocket technology for instant updates, differentiating it from traditional IDEs that require manual refreshes.
vs alternatives: More responsive than traditional IDEs like Visual Studio Code for collaborative work due to real-time synchronization.
Replit provides an integrated development environment (IDE) that allows users to write and execute code directly in the browser without needing local setup. This is achieved through containerized environments that spin up quickly and support multiple programming languages, allowing users to see immediate results from their code. The architecture abstracts away the complexity of local installations and dependencies.
Unique: Offers a fully integrated environment that runs code in isolated containers, making it easier to manage dependencies and execution contexts.
vs alternatives: Faster setup and execution than local environments like Jupyter Notebook, especially for beginners.
Replit includes features for deploying applications directly from the IDE with a single click. This capability leverages CI/CD pipelines that automatically build and deploy code changes to a live environment, utilizing Docker containers for consistent deployment across different environments. This streamlines the development workflow and reduces the friction of moving from development to production.
Unique: Integrates deployment directly within the coding environment, eliminating the need for external tools or services.
vs alternatives: More streamlined than using separate CI/CD tools like Jenkins or GitHub Actions, especially for small projects.
Replit offers interactive coding tutorials that allow users to learn programming concepts directly within the platform. These tutorials are built using a combination of guided exercises and instant feedback mechanisms, enabling users to practice coding in real-time while receiving hints and corrections. The architecture supports embedding these tutorials in various formats, making them accessible and engaging.
Unique: Combines coding practice with instant feedback in a single platform, unlike traditional tutorial websites that lack execution capabilities.
vs alternatives: More engaging than static tutorial sites like Codecademy, as users can code and receive feedback simultaneously.
Replit includes built-in package management that automatically resolves dependencies for various programming languages. This is achieved through integration with language-specific package repositories, allowing users to install and manage libraries directly from the IDE. The system also handles version conflicts and ensures that the correct versions of libraries are used, simplifying the setup process for projects.
Unique: Offers seamless integration with language package repositories, allowing for automatic dependency resolution without manual configuration.
vs alternatives: More user-friendly than command-line package managers like npm or pip, especially for new developers.
